April and Oct are intermonsoonal intervals characterized by sluggish air actions and extreme afternoon showers and thunderstorms. Altogether, Singapore’s precipitation averages about ninety five inches annually, and rain falls somewhere to the island every day in the 12 months.

Following Planet War I, the British created the big Singapore Naval Base as part of the defensive Singapore system.[32] First declared in 1921, the construction of the base went at a sluggish tempo right until the Japanese invasion of Manchuria in 1931. Costing $sixty million instead of entirely accomplished in 1938, it had been the largest dry dock on earth, more info the third-major floating dock, and experienced enough gasoline tanks to help the whole British Navy for 6 months.

Before independence in 1965, Hokkien, a Chinese dialect, was the prevalent language One of the Chinese laborers. Malay and English were being employed to speak concerning the several ethnic teams.
